The Beauty in Small Moments
Ode to the Little Things

In the quiet corners of the day,
Where whispers of sunlight play,
Lies the magic of the small and fine,
In moments fleeting, yet divine.
A raindrop's dance upon a leaf,
A child's laughter, pure and brief,
The warmth of a familiar touch,
Or the melody of a bird's hushed hutch.
In these fragments, life unfolds,
Stories in whispers, tales untold,
For it's not in grandeur we find our way,
But in the little things, day by day.
So cherish each gentle smile,
Embrace the mundane for a while,
For in these humble, quiet seams,
Lives the essence of our dreams.
